CC3200 —— No.1 环境搭建(更新于2020年5月1日)

之前写过一次CC3200环境搭建的教程,但是由于是两年前了,当时使用的CCS还是8.0的版本,如今很多软件都已经更新,于是打算重新再更新一下搭建的过程。

软件准备

首先是查看官网最新发布的CC3200的SDK说明:传送门

在这里插入图片描述
目前CC3200的SDK 已经更新到1.5.0版本,而Service Pack也更新到1.0.1.14-2.12.2.8,同时适配的TI-RTOS也使用了针对CC3200的版本2.16.01.14。
查看一下 View release notes 可以找到关于该SDK的一些更新说明
在这里插入图片描述
可以看到该SDK是基于CCS 8.3以及编译器18.1.4的版本。
而目前最新发行的CCS已经更新到了10.0版本,对于热爱尝鲜的我,自然是选择最新的CCS了,接下来就是基于CCS v10来搭建CC3200开发环境的教程。

软件包准备

所有软件包,我都整理好上传至百度云,方便大家下载
链接:https://pan.baidu.com/s/116SmsOxSu1uI8gDOcwiReA
提取码:0v45

  1. CCS v10.0.00010 :传送门
    ​​在这里插入图片描述
  2. CC3200_SDK v1.5.0:传送门,下载这两个包还需要帐号登陆一下。
    在这里插入图片描述
  3. TI-RTOS v2.16.01.14:传送门
    在这里插入图片描述
  4. UNIFLASH v3.4.1:传送门,只有这个版本才支持CC3200
    在这里插入图片描述
    在这里插入图片描述

软件安装

下载好这5个软件包后,建议安装在同一个目录下,我都是安装在 “D:\ti” 这个目录下。
在这里插入图片描述
注意,TI-RTOS最好是安装在ccs1000目录中,这样CCS启动时会发现有新的插件,而不用自己导入。
在这里插入图片描述

导入必要工程

  1. 新建工作空间,我将文件夹新建在SDK文件夹中
    在这里插入图片描述

  2. 运气好的话打开CCS会自动跳出发现新插件的窗口,如果没有跳出来,那需要手动添加一下,那个 controlSUITE 是其他包,这里忽略,安装完重启即可。
    在这里插入图片描述
    再次查看,可以看到TI-RTOS 2.16.1.14 和 XDCtools 3.32.0.06已经导入。
    在这里插入图片描述

  3. 导入操作系统工程,这在一些示例是非必须的,但只要涉及到WIFI部分,就一定需要。导入 oslibti_rtos_config,切记不要勾选Copy projects into workspace,否则会破坏路径关联性,错误暂时不用考虑。 在这里插入图片描述

  4. 导入driverlibsimplelink工程,一个是驱动部分,一个是WIFI底层部分。这里可以看到导入时默认勾选了Copy projects into workspace这个框。在这里插入图片描述

配置工程参数

  1. 将4个工程的编译器版本均配置为最新
    在这里插入图片描述
  2. 配置 oslib 为 TI-RTOS
    在这里插入图片描述
  3. 配置 ti_rtos_config 参数,使TI-RTOS 和 XDS版本匹配。
    在这里插入图片描述
  4. 编译全部工程
    在这里插入图片描述

导入第一个工程

在这里插入图片描述
默认会选上Copy projects into workspace,配置最新编译器版本后,打开common.h
将默认的WIFI的SSID和KEY配置成自家路由器的配置
在这里插入图片描述
保存代码,并编译。接下来就是连接目标板
在这里插入图片描述
插入数据线,通过设备管理器里查询到串口号 COM4在这里插入图片描述
首先打开UNIFLASH进行格式化和Service Pack Programming
请添加图片描述
然后去掉SOP2的短路帽,使板子选择JTAG模式
接着回到CCS,选择仿真工具
在这里插入图片描述
进行Debug和终端配置
在这里插入图片描述
可以看到CC3200 成功连接到路由器,并获取到了IP地址。
第一个Hello world教程完毕!!

  • 9
    点赞
  • 31
    收藏
    觉得还不错? 一键收藏
  • 4
    评论
CC2530环境配置可以参考以下步骤: 1. 首先,按照《2530开发环境搭建与快速入门攻略》文档的介绍,安装IAR。 2. 打开IAR,建立工程文件。根据文档中的指导,进行工程的创建和命名。 3. 在工程文件中,配置参数。根据文档中的指导,选择合适的Outputformat,如将Outputformat栏中内容改为intel-extended。 4. 进行烧录。根据文档中的指导,选择适当的烧录方法来将程序烧录到CC2530上。 5. 如果需要,可以参考文档中提供的简单例程,来验证环境配置是否成功。 6. 最后,保存创建的工作区。在菜单栏中点击File->Save Workspace,将工作区保存下来,以便下次使用。 通过以上步骤,你可以完成CC2530环境的配置。请注意,以上步骤仅为一般指导,具体的操作可能会有些差异,具体还需要参考《2530开发环境搭建与快速入门攻略》文档中的详细说明。<span class="em">1</span><span class="em">2</span><span class="em">3</span> #### 引用[.reference_title] - *1* [CC2530单片机开发技术 开发环境搭建与快速入门攻略.docx](https://download.csdn.net/download/it__rain/11694913)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"] - *2* *3* [IAR环境配置教程(CC2530版)](https://blog.csdn.net/m0_65909265/article/details/125536053)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"] [ .reference_list ]
评论 4
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值